Solution for 3(3n+4)=9(9n+9)+1 equation:



3(3n+4)=9(9n+9)+1
We move all terms to the left:
3(3n+4)-(9(9n+9)+1)=0
We multiply parentheses
9n-(9(9n+9)+1)+12=0
We calculate terms in parentheses: -(9(9n+9)+1), so:
9(9n+9)+1
We multiply parentheses
81n+81+1
We add all the numbers together, and all the variables
81n+82
Back to the equation:
-(81n+82)
We get rid of parentheses
9n-81n-82+12=0
We add all the numbers together, and all the variables
-72n-70=0
We move all terms containing n to the left, all other terms to the right
-72n=70
n=70/-72
n=-35/36
